Discover the high-tech origins of a phrase about low-tech gossip. During the American Civil War, hastily strung telegraph wires sagged and twisted from tree to tree, resembling wild grapevines. While official dispatches traveled the wires, the unreliable rumors that circulated alongside them became known as the "grapevine telegraph"—a network as tangled and doubtful as the physical lines themselves.
